Concord Prison Outreach Presents A Special Community Event

Harold Clarke

Commissioner of the Massachusetts Department Of Correction

Harold Clarke

Wednesday, April 9, 2008, 7 pm Trinitarian Congregational Church 54 Walden St. (Hubbard Street entrance) Concord, Ma.

Free of charge, bring a friend or neighbor

Speaking on:

  1. The Commissioner’s Vision and what it means for our communities

  2. The current state of Massachusetts prisons and his vision for maintaining security for our communities while also helping inmates learn to become productive working citizens, which in turn would reduce costs for taxpayers.

  3. His mandate to revamp the Massachusetts Department of Correction and the impact this may have on our towns and the roles we can play together.

Also sponsored by: LWV, Human Rights Council, First Parish, Holy Family Catholic Church, TriCon, Trinity Episcopal Church, and West Concord Union Church.
